**Ticket: Config drift on BounceSift processor**

The email bounce processor in the Larkfield environment has drifted from the values committed in the release branch. Retry windows and suppression thresholds no longer match, which likely explains the duplicate suppression entries reported Tuesday. Please reconcile before the Thursday cut. For reference, the currently deployed configuration on the live node reads as follows.

config for yajep-yahof:
[briax]
port = 9200
region = outer-2
host = briax.nelvrocorp.test
team = raleth
timeout_ms = 1500
retries = 1

Board briefing: the franchise agreement with Copperfen Kitchens is basically ready to sign. Terms look fair — seven-year term, territorial exclusivity across the Halloway region, and a royalty structure that steps down after year three. Legal flagged one clause on signage standards, now resolved. Honestly, this is the smoothest negotiation we've had since the Pinebrook deal. We'd like approval at next week's session. One sensitive planning item is appended directly below.

management briefing: Only 5 of the 80 pilot accounts renewed Zorix, so a churn review is set for October 1.

## v4.2.1 — Connection Pooling Overhaul

Replaced the legacy per-request connection model in Quillbase with a shared pool managed by the new PoolWarden module. Default pool size is 20 with a 30-second idle timeout, configurable via quillbase.pool.* settings. This eliminates the connection exhaustion incidents seen during the Tarnow datacenter failover tests. Rollback requires reverting both the config schema and migration 118. No downtime expected; pool warms up within five seconds of deploy. Questions on this release go to the engineer below.

named custodian: Brivan Eliath Quenox Frador

Runbook: Quillhopper queue cutover. This week we retire the homegrown Taskwell queue and migrate all workers to Quillhopper. Drain Taskwell by pausing producers at least 20 minutes before the deploy window, verify zero in-flight jobs via the admin panel, then roll workers in batches of three. The migration bundle must be signed before artifact upload; use the key below.

rollout seal: bky19_M1Zvn1YQwEBTy4XxP3H